Buying Guide: Key Considerations for Golf Ball Wall Displays
- Display intent: Choose open racks for easy access and rotation, or closed, lockable cabinets for dust protection and security.
- Mounting and weight: Verify wall studs and hardware compatibility with the cabinet’s weight when fully loaded. Heavier units may require anchoring and professional installation.
- Material and finish: Wood offers a traditional look; metal and acrylic can provide a modern vibe. Consider room style and existing furniture to ensure cohesion.
- Protection from light and dust: UV-protected doors and dust-sealing designs preserve ball color, label integrity, and autographs over time.
- Capacity and layout: Determine how many balls you want to display and whether you prefer single-tier shelves, multiple rows, or a sculptural display for collectibles.
- Security: Lockable doors and anti-theft features are important for high-value or irreplaceable balls.
- Maintenance: Easy-to-clean interiors and removable shelves simplify upkeep and ball rotation.
- Placement considerations: Measure wall space to ensure the display fits without obstructing doors, windows, or seating areas.
- Budget and aesthetic balance: Higher capacity and premium finishes increase cost, but deliver a longer-lasting, museum-like presentation.
